| Name | Birth Year | Relationship to Arnold | Notable Role or Contribution |
|---|---|---|---|
| Maria Shriver | 1955 | Wife (m. 1986–2011) | Journalist, activist, former First Lady of California |
| Katherine Schwarzenegger | 1989 | Daughter | Author, advocate, animal welfare activist |
| Patrick Schwarzenegger | 1993 | Son | Actor, model, entrepreneur |
| Christopher Schwarzenegger | 1997 | Son | Actor, model |
| Joseph Baena | 1997 | Son (with Mildred Patricia Baena) | Actor, fitness entrepreneur |
Arnold Schwarzenegger Family Background and Heritage
Roots in Austria and Early Life
Arnold Schwarzenegger was born in Thal, Austria, in 1947, the son of a police chief and a mother who encouraged his early interest in sports. His strict upbringing and competitive environment fostered the discipline that later defined his bodybuilding and acting careers.

Political Career and Family Dynamics
Governorship and Family Involvement
As Governor of California from 2003 to 2011, Schwarzenegger’s family navigated life in the public eye while managing policy priorities. His children engaged in advocacy work, and his wife took on significant roles in education and public health initiatives.
Challenges and Public Disclosure
The revelation of his extramarital affair and subsequent separation from Maria Shriver tested family cohesion. Despite the personal turmoil, Schwarzenegger maintained a commitment to his children, striving to provide stability amid highly publicized conflict.
